What does unblooded mean?

Looking for the meaning or definition of the word unblooded? Here's what it means.

Adjective
  1. Not yet blooded; still to take part in combat.

Examples
The Russians would beat the Germans and Canada's overseas army would return home unblooded.
She is still unblooded but if the hounds had flushed out a fox then the huntsman can hold them back and let the bird try to get it.
The lowest point in Sturridge's career came at the Baseball ground in a reserves game when he was an unblooded 17-year-old, against another former club Leicester City.
